Samsung has trademarked Galaxy A6, Galaxy A8 and Galaxy A9 names
Samsung already has a huge portfolio of current-gen smartphones including the aluminium frame bearing A series. At present we have the Galaxy A3, Galaxy A5 and Galaxy A7 already available in the market and with the recent trademarks we expect that Samsung may have already starting working on the next iteration with the Galaxy A6, A8 and A9.
The Galaxy A series of smartphones are characterized by the use of a aluminium alloy frames with unibody design, Super AMOLED displays and specs ranging from mid to high-end. Samsung won't be launching the new Galaxy A series smartphones anytime soon but IFA 2015 might be a good place to showcase these new phones.
